Transaction 66a9957903bd5c1e3ae0817730fc46121848699ff6856133278fa092d64a16e4
1 Input
1 Output
-
66a9957903bd5c1e3ae0817730fc46121848699ff6856133278fa092d64a16e4:0
- value
- 140000
- script pubkey
- OP_0 OP_PUSHBYTES_20 943c1ced03b4b56ecd5a15782c8c886abee218f3
- address
- bc1qjs7pemgrkj6kan26z4uzerygd2lwyx8nfwwjhm